Data Platform Developer (m/f/d)

For our costumer, we are looking for a fulltime Data Platform Developer (m/f/d) with Big Data Experience.

Location: approx. 80% remote, 20% onsite

Tasks

Data/Data MeshCapabilities development:

  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able data architectures, including databases, data lakes, and data warehouses. - Implement best practices for data storage, retrieval, and processing.
  • Drive the adoption of Data Mesh principles, promoting decentralized data ownership and architecture.
  • Conceptualize, design, and implement Data Mesh Proof of Concepts (PoCs) to validate decentralized data architectures.
  • Implement a comprehensive data catalog to document metadata, data lineage, and data dictionaries for all data assets. Ensure that data is easily discoverable and accessible across the organization.

Data Products:

  • Develop and maintain reusable data products that serve various business units. These data products should ensure high-quality, reliable data that can be easily integrated and utilized across different platforms and applications.
  • Design and implement data models supporting business requirements.
  • Collaborate closely with data scientists and analysts to understand and structure data needs.
  • Develop and maintain 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es for moving and transforming data from various sources into the data infrastructure aligning with Data Mesh principles

Data Quality and Governance:

  • Implement and enforce data quality standards and governance policies.
  • Develop and maintain data documentation for metadata, lineage, and data dictionaries.

Platform Adaptation:

  • Design and implement Kubernetes-based deployment strategies for scalable, reliable, and manageable data technologies.
  • Collaborate with DevOps and Infrastructure teams to optimize data technology deployment processes within a Kubernetes environment.

Documentation:

  • Document Data Mesh implementations, PoC results, and best practices for knowledge sharing and future reference
